Horse Racing Basic Terms

Paddock

The area where horses gather before the race to be saddled and paraded for the public.

Breeder

The owner of a horse’s dam – or mother - at the time a horse is foaled.

Track Bias

The term used to identify which parts of the track or running styles are producing more winners.
